Transaction 670e995395bc03175fe39e037a89310bc1c19b1e690fb43d2fcee1860beac151
1 Input
1 Output
-
670e995395bc03175fe39e037a89310bc1c19b1e690fb43d2fcee1860beac151:0
- value
- 6315
- script pubkey
- OP_0 OP_PUSHBYTES_20 224d39d81c7c8bdbe148030a33198644b74627be
- address
- bc1qyfxnnkqu0j9ahc2gqv9rxxvxgjm5vfa7zjlf3w